Importance of Proper Storage and Maintenance

Proper storage and maintenance of medical equipment are essential for several reasons:

  1. Ensuring Patient Safety: Malfunctioning or poorly maintained equipment can pose a significant risk to patients' safety and well-being.
  2. Preventing Equipment Failures: Regular maintenance helps prevent equipment failures that can disrupt healthcare services and lead to adverse outcomes.
  3. Prolonging Equipment Lifespan: Proper storage and maintenance can extend the lifespan of medical equipment, reducing the need for frequent replacements and saving costs for the hospital.

Guidelines for Proper Storage of Medical Equipment

Proper storage of medical equipment is essential to maintain its functionality and integrity. Hospitals should follow these guidelines for storing medical equipment:

1. Designated Storage Areas

Allocate specific storage areas for different types of medical equipment to prevent overcrowding and ensure easy access for staff members.

2. Climate Control

Maintain proper environmental conditions, including temperature and humidity levels, to prevent damage to sensitive equipment.

3. Organization and Labeling

Ensure that medical equipment is organized systematically and labeled accurately to facilitate quick identification and retrieval.

4. Security Measures

Implement security measures, such as access controls and surveillance systems, to prevent theft and unauthorized use of medical equipment.

Guidelines for Proper Maintenance of Medical Equipment

Routine maintenance of medical equipment is essential to keep it in optimal working condition and minimize the risk of malfunctions. Hospitals should adhere to the following guidelines for maintaining medical equipment:

1. Scheduled Inspections

Conduct regular inspections of medical equipment to identify any issues or defects that require immediate attention.

2. Calibration and Testing

Calibrate and test medical equipment periodically to ensure accuracy and reliability in diagnostic and treatment procedures.

3. Staff Training

Provide training to staff members on the proper use and maintenance of medical equipment to prevent misuse and ensure compliance with guidelines.

4. Manufacturer Guidelines

Follow manufacturers' guidelines and recommendations for the maintenance and servicing of medical equipment to avoid voiding warranties and causing damage.

Compliance with Safety Regulations

Hospitals in the United States must comply with safety Regulations established by regulatory bodies, such as the Food and Drug Administration (FDA) and the Occupational Safety and Health Administration (OSHA). These Regulations outline specific requirements for the storage and maintenance of medical equipment to ensure patient safety and quality healthcare delivery.
